1. DESCRIPTION
ePowerSwitch*1G
R2
is a power control unit with a built-in Web server, an Ethernet and a RS232
connection. It enables to control the power supply of 1 power outlet1s through an Ethernet connection.
This unit offers additional IP device monitoring. It has a Real Time Clock to trigger scheduled actions and
timestamp all events. Its serial interface enables to control the power outlet over a Terminal connection
(KVM Switch, console server...) and to trigger a soft shutdown of a server with shutdown capabilities.
The ePowerSwitch 1G
R2
supports the HTTP, DHCP, Syslog, SNMP and SNTP protocols.

10/100 (RJ45 Connector)
Network connection 10/100 Mbits/sec
Green LED
Off = Network connection not detected
On = Network connection detected
Flashing = the device is sending or receiving data over this port
Yellow LED
Off = 10 Mbits/sec connection
On = 100 Mbits/sec connection
